Cases — July 11th through 17th, 2021

Scott Ellsworth - July 22, 2021January 18, 2022 - Miscellaneous, Procedure, Public Employees, Utah Supreme Court

Miscellaneous

Sheppard v. Geneva Rock (Utah, July 15, 2021) (reversing the district court’s grant of Geneva Rock‘s motion in limine excluding, as irrelevant, all liability evidence, and holding as error the court’s exclusion of Geneva Rock‘s employment practices: that evidence was still relevant after Geneva Rock had admitted liability)

Public Emloyers ~ Employees

Ramon v. Nebo School District (Utah, July 15 2021) (reversing dismissal of Ramon’s negligent employment claim and rejecting the bright-line approach of some other jurisdictions barring negligent employment claims when an employer admits financial responsibility for its employee’s liability)
